II. The Conversion Factor: Centimeters to Inches



The core of any unit conversion lies in the conversion factor. This factor represents the ratio between the two units you're converting. For centimeters and inches, the conversion factor is approximately:

1 inch (in) ≈ 2.54 centimeters (cm)

This means that one inch is equal to 2.54 centimeters. This factor is crucial for our conversion.


III. Converting 162.56 cm to Inches: The Calculation



To convert 162.56 cm to inches, we'll use the conversion factor. Since 1 inch is equal to 2.54 cm, we can set up a proportion:

1 in / 2.54 cm = x in / 162.56 cm

To solve for 'x' (the number of inches), we can cross-multiply:

x in = (162.56 cm 1 in) / 2.54 cm

The 'cm' units cancel out, leaving us with:

x in ≈ 64 in

Therefore, 162.56 centimeters is approximately equal to 64 inches.
